Pup not feeding

can anyone give me advice my whippett bitch had 8 pups friday night 7 of them doing well but one is not feeding at all, i am putting her on the teet but not suckerling at all any advice pleasexxxxx.

i am putting her on the teet but not suckerling at all any advice please
Hi, has a vet seen the puppies, has the puppy been checked for a cleft pallet a condition which makes suckling difficult ? Is the bitch licking the puppy or ignoring it , does it feel colder than the others.
If there is something wrong with a puppy it will often feels/smell odd to the dam and she may ignore it or push it to one side where it gets cold.

In addition to the advice already given, to help the puppy identify the teat before putting it to suckle try holding it to the bitch so she can lick its mouth (when the dam cleans her teats then licks her puppies she leaves a chemical trail in her saliva which helps the puppies to scent/locate her teats) . Also put the puppy onto the back teats which usually have the most milk.

If the puppy is to weak too suckle you will need to get an eye dropper from the chemist and use this to feed the puppy with a puppy milk like Lactol .
If you are feeing the puppy, after each feed don't forget to take a piece of warm wet cotton wool and to wipe the puppy's tummy to stimulate it to relieve itself.

Hi everyone not been on her since this post, you where right met took her to the gets she had a cleft pallet took her home to spend time with her, then I had to take her back to be put to sleep very upsetting .
